Jessy Strohmeyer currently serves as a Client Intake and Legal Assistant at Pacific Northwest Family Law since May 2023. Additionally, Jessy has been working as a food delivery driver for both DoorDash and Uber since February 2023. In the volunteer capacity, Jessy serves as an Arts Commissioner for the City of Kennewick and is involved with the Art & Wine Committee at St. Joseph's Catholic School since November 2019. Previous professional experience includes teaching art and craft classes at North Kansas City Public Library, performing conservation work at Etherington Conservation Services, and holding various assistant roles in academic and administrative settings such as the University of Missouri-Saint Louis and the U.S. National Archives. Jessy holds a Bachelor of Arts degree in Anthropology and Archaeology from the University of Missouri-Saint Louis, completed in 2005.
City of Kennewick
Located in beautiful southeastern Washington State, Kennewick is the largest of the Tri-Cities Metropolitan Statistical Area and at the forefront of statewide growth. Benefiting from a talented labor force, steady job market and low cost of living, Kennewick is a thriving city attracting tourism and a reputation for fun. The pursuit of happiness stretches 26 square miles and features a variety of sports and recreational activities, entertainment, the region’s retail shopping hub and a casual, easy-living vibe. Nestled in the heart of Washington wine country, Kennewick boasts over 160 wineries within a 50 mile radius. More than 300 days of sunshine and its location along the Columbia River provide a variety of recreational activities including world-class fishing, birding, bike trails and parks.
